    Subject[PATCH 1/6] driver-core: platform: Provide helpers for multi-driver modules
    Date
    From: Thierry Reding <treding@nvidia.com>

    Some modules register several sub-drivers. Provide a helper that makes
    it easy to register and unregister a list of sub-drivers, as well as
    unwind properly on error.

    +Kernel modules can be composed of several platform drivers. The platform core
    +provides helpers to register and unregister an array of drivers:
    +
    + int platform_register_drivers(struct platform_driver * const *drivers,
    + unsigned int count);
    + void platform_unregister_drivers(struct platform_driver * const *drivers,
    + unsigned int count);
    +
    +If one of the drivers fails to register, all drivers registered up to that
    +point will be unregistered in reverse order.

    +/**
    + * platform_register_drivers - register an array of platform drivers
    + * @drivers: an array of drivers to register
    + * @count: the number of drivers to register
    + *
    + * Registers platform drivers specified by an array. On failure to register a
    + * driver, all previously registered drivers will be unregistered. Callers of
    + * this API should use platform_unregister_drivers() to unregister drivers in
    + * the reverse order.
    + *
    + * Returns: 0 on success or a negative error code on failure.
    + */
    +int platform_register_drivers(struct platform_driver * const *drivers,
    + unsigned int count)
    +{
    + unsigned int i;
    + int err;
    +
    + for (i = 0; i < count; i++) {
    + pr_debug("registering platform driver %ps\n", drivers[i]);
    +
    + err = platform_driver_register(drivers[i]);
    + if (err < 0) {
    + pr_err("failed to register platform driver %ps: %d\n",
    + drivers[i], err);
    + goto error;
    + }
    + }
    +
    + return 0;
    +
    +error:
    + while (i--) {
    + pr_debug("unregistering platform driver %ps\n", drivers[i]);
    + platform_driver_unregister(drivers[i]);
    + }
    +
    + return err;
    +}
    +EXPORT_SYMBOL_GPL(platform_register_drivers);
    +
    +/**
    + * platform_unregister_drivers - unregister an array of platform drivers
    + * @drivers: an array of drivers to unregister
    + * @count: the number of drivers to unregister
    + *
    + * Unegisters platform drivers specified by an array. This is typically used
    + * to complement an earlier call to platform_register_drivers(). Drivers are
    + * unregistered in the reverse order in which they were registered.
    + */
    +void platform_unregister_drivers(struct platform_driver * const *drivers,
    + unsigned int count)
    +{
    + while (count--) {
    + pr_debug("unregistering platform driver %ps\n", drivers[count]);
    + platform_driver_unregister(drivers[count]);
    + }
    +}
    +EXPORT_SYMBOL_GPL(platform_unregister_drivers);
